This scientific paper meticulously details the discovery, description, and classification of a previously unknown genus and species of fish from the Pennsylvanian period, unearthed in Kansas. Authored by Joan Echols, the work provides a rigorous paleontological analysis of a fossil specimen, identifying it as a Crossopterygii within the Coelacanthiformes order. It systematically outlines the morphological characteristics that differentiate this new genus from existing species, thereby contributing significantly to the understanding of ancient aquatic ecosystems and the evolutionary history of coelacanths.
